What is Heurist Mesh?
Heurist Mesh is the skills marketplace for AI agents. General-purpose AI models lack specialized knowledge about Web3, and often fail to deliver accurate and relevant results. Heurist Mesh solves this by providing a marketplace of specialized AI agents that are experts in crypto analytics, ready to give your applications or agents the crypto expertise they need.
- Composable Architecture: Mix and match specialized agents for different tasks
- Flexible Access: We support REST API with API key access, x402-enabled pay-per-use API, and MCP access. Agents are registered with ERC-8004 Trusted Agents standard.
- Curated Web3 Tools: We curate the best Web3 tools to give your agents the best possible performance. We constantly monitor and update the tools we use to ensure they are always performant.
- Optimized for Agents: The input and output formats are optimized for AI agents to easily comprehend and use. Tool call rounds are reduced by 70% and token usage is reduced by 30~50% compared to simple API wrappers.

Available Agents
Heurist Mesh provides 30+ specialized agents spanning across these categories:
- Aggregated crypto insights (Recommended for crypto use cases)
- Token Resolver: get detailed informationa and market data for any token
- Twitter Intelligence: smart search on Twitter
- Trending Tokens: find trending tokens across all chains and social media
- Token information (CoinGecko, DexScreener, Bitquery, etc.)
- Social media (Twitter, Elfa, Moni, etc.)
- Blockchain data (Etherscan, ChainBase, Space and Time, etc.)
- Web Search (Exa, Firecrawl, with AI extraction and summarization)
- Crypto products (Pump.fun, LetsBonk, Zora, etc.)
- Wallet analysis (Pond AI, GoPlus, Zerion, etc.)
